DWP Consultation : Guaranteed Minimum Pension (GMP) Equalisation

27 January 2012 The Department of Work and Pensions has launched a consultation on new draft regulations for Guaranteed Minimum Pension (GMP) equalisation along with a proposed possible method for accomplishing equality of treatment. Progress on this consultation has already proven unusual as it has already excited significant negative press comment and is likely to continue to prove controversial.

Department of Work and Pensions : Meeting Future Workplace Pension Challenges

19 December 2011 The Department of Work and Pensions has launched a consultation on how to treat the proliferation of small pension pots. An individual moving from job to job may easily build up a portfolio of several small entitlements with consequent problems of administration, communication and cost. Department of Work and Pensions : consultation on Amendment of Occupational Pension Schemes (Levies) Regulations

21 November 2011 The Department of Work and Pensions is consulting on a proposed amendment of the Occupational Pension Schemes (Levies) Regulations 2005. This proposed amendment deals with the levy which is charged to schemes and used to pay the administration costs of the Pensions Ombudsman, the Pensions Advisory Service and parts of the Pensions Regulator. The levy is raised from schemes on a per-member basis and has not been reviewed in some time. DWP : workplace pension reform

19 July 2011 The Department of Work and Pensions is seeking views on new draft regulations relating to the Government’s workplace pension reforms – the Automatic Enrolment (Miscellaneous Amendments) Regulations 2011 and the Automatic Enrolment (Miscellaneous Amendments) (No. 2) Regulations 2011.
